Glossary Term
Exhort
Context-sensitive: use baryid (entreat/beseech) for pleading; dhiirigelin (embolden/encourage) for building up.

Glossary Term
Jesus
CRITICAL: Ciise is the shared Somali/Qur'anic name for Jesus and alone signals only the Qur'anic prophet-Jesus to most readers.

Doctrine
Kingdom Mission
God's reign advancing through the gospel, not a literal government (dawladda) — a fraught category in a country that has lacked a fully functioning central state for decades.

Doctrine
Lordship of Christ
CRITICAL: Romans 10:9 — Ciise waa Rabbiga is the salvation confession and must be rendered without qualification.
